JAKARTA - Ovarium cancer is among the deadliest diseases in gynecology. This is because ovarian cancer is difficult to detect early and is usually caught when it is in advanced stages.
With that, specialist obstetrician and gynecologist consultant oncology, dr. Muhammad Yusuf, Sp.OG (K) Onk, said that women's awareness regarding the risk factors of ovarian cancer is very important for prevention and early detection. These are some of the risk factors for ovarian cancer that women must watch out for.
1. History of cancer in the family
Genetic factors are an important indicator of the chances of ovarian cancer in a woman. Women with families who have been exposed to ovarian cancer or breast cancer should be vigilant and start regular health checks.
"If there are mothers, grandmothers, or siblings who have had cancer, the risk will also increase. Especially if they are young," said doctor Yusuf, during a press conference at AstraZeneca in Gatot Subroto, Jakarta, on July 24, 2025.
In some cases, genetic factors such as the mutation of the BRCA1 and BRCA2 genes have indeed proven to significantly increase the risk of ovarian cancer.
2. Menstruation early and menopause late
A woman's menstrual period, whether menstruating too early or too late, increases the risk of being exposed to estrogen for a long time. This can trigger abnormal cells in the ovarian, which can end in cancer.
"The longer a woman is exposed to the hormone estrogen, either due to early menstruation or late menopause, the higher the risk of ovarian cancer," he said.
3. Never get pregnant
Pregnancy can also affect the occurrence of ovarian cancer. Women who are never pregnant can actually be more at risk of developing ovarian cancer, because it is related to the period of body ovulation that never stops.
"Every ovulation is like a small wound that heals on its own. But if it is too often it can cause potential cell disorders," he explained.
4. Obesity
Excessive weight or obesity is also a risk factor for ovarian cancer. Obesity increases the risk of ovarian cancer through a hormonal mechanism.

An unhealthy lifestyle that causes excessive weight, becomes a pattern that is often found in women of productive age. This must be changed because it secretly increases the risk of developing ovarian cancer.
